4. The service
Newsfable generates daily personalised email newsletters based on the configuration you create. Each newsletter:
- Uses a retrieval pipeline (the Podcast RAG API) that searches public podcast transcripts.
- Sends the retrieved excerpts and your prompt to a large-language-model provider that produces a summary.
- Is emailed daily to the destination address on the newsletter, at the local time you configured.
You can edit, pause, or delete any newsletter at any time, and you can send a test issue to yourself before daily scheduled delivery.

7. AI-generated content
Newsletters are generated by automated retrieval and large-language-model summarisation. They may contain inaccuracies, omissions, or hallucinated facts. You should:
- Treat newsletter content as a starting point, not a verified source.
- Verify any factual claim against the underlying episode before relying on it for decisions.
- Use the included timestamps and links to listen to the source moments where accuracy matters.
We do not warrant that any newsletter is accurate, complete, or current.
